Deidara was born in Iwagakure, the Village Hidden in the Stone, where he was a direct student of the Third Tsuchikage, ÅŒnoki. The master was known to be arrogant, stubborn and proud. At one point, however, after ÅŒnoki sees Gaara’s leadership and Naruto’s trajectory, he admits the mistakes he’s made along the way.
Although ÅŒnoki was often annoyed at Deidara – and even mocked his pupil’s explosive clay art, much to Deidara’s frustration – he also took great pride in his pupil’s growth and powers.
During his youth, he received praise for the clay sculptures he made in his training. But Deidara aimed higher. As a member of the Explosion Corps, he had the Explosion Release Kekkei genkai, a technique that allows the user to use explosive chakra to cause objects they come in contact with to explode. His objective was, then, to unite this ability to Iwagakure’s kinjutsu, a resource that makes it possible to knead chakra into substances.
Without measuring consequences to obtain it, the shinobi (ninja) violated the laws of his village and stole the kinjutsu (prohibited technique). With the union of the two techniques, Deidara was able to mold his explosive chakra into a clay with which he could build species of living explosives, of varying shapes and sizes, which could be used to hit opponents even at great distances, with the detonation being activated by Katsu command. After committing this crime, Deidara fled Iwagakure.

As a missing-nin (fugitive ninja), Deidara went on to help rebels from different countries, specializing his art and combat technique and becoming a kind of terrorist bomber. And it was exactly the fame he began to gain from his performance that caught the attention of the criminal organization Akatsuki.
On orders from Pain, leader of Akatsuki, members Sasori, Itachi Uchiha, and Kisame Hoshigaki set out in search of Deidara to recruit him into the group. When the missing-nin refused, Itachi decided to challenge him to combat, with the result deciding whether or not to join the new member. Deidara accepted, but was easily defeated by Itachi’s Sharingan and has since joined Akatsuki.
Having been defeated by Itachi and being aware that the Sharingan is more powerful than his own technique, his art, Deidara fueled a great hatred of Itachi and his brother Sasuke. During his time in Akatsuki, the missing-nin planned to take revenge on Itachi, even developing the C4 technique, with which he would be able to counter the older Uchiha’s Sharingan and kill him.
Deidara’s first partner in Akatsuki was Sasori, someone with whom the missing-nin shared a taste for art. A mixture of lonely childhood and a fascination with puppet theater motivated Sasori to transform himself into a kind of human puppet, equipping his body with weapons and other resources, which allowed him, for example, to control his opponents like puppets. For Sasori, art was something to be left for the future.
At one point in the story, the duo set out on a mission to capture Gaara and try to extract from him the Ichibi no Shukaku, also known as the One-Tail, since one of Akatsuki’s goals was to gather all the Tailed Beasts (Tailed Beasts) and use their powers to start wars. The plan was for the mercenary group to be called in and paid to stop those wars, which the villages didn’t know they were causing. This quest for reputation and money caused the financial collapse of several villages.
During Gaara’s capture, however, Deidara and Sasori were cornered and defeated by Kakashi Hatake and Naruto. Sasori died in the battle, and Deidara was maimed. Still, the confrontation caused the missing-nin to spark an interest in fighting Naruto, after realizing that he was indeed a jinchÅ«riki (bearer of one of the tailed beasts) of extraordinary power.

The relationship between Deidara and Tobi couldn’t be more different from the one the missing-nin had with his former partner. Tobi’s constant banter annoyed Deidara to the point that, at certain times, they broke up during missions.
Still, they ended up fighting well together, helping each other in battles, even if they didn’t agree on who helped who or who was responsible for the victory. When the duo receives news that Orochimaru is dead, they decide to look for his killer, as they both wanted to have been responsible for ending the former Akatsuki member’s life. Upon encountering the one who killed Orochimaru, Sasuke Uchiha, Deidara engages in battle with the shinobi, while being assisted by Tobi.
